Description of Job If you love numbers, you may want to look into ourTaxation Division Team! TheTaxation Divisionpromotes voluntary compliance with all tax laws through education, assistance and customer service. TheService Centerserves about 200,000 customers each year. What We Do TheService Centersserve as the "face" of the Taxation Division and our team of dedicated professionals work collaboratively within the Customer Contact Group to promote voluntary compliance with tax laws through education, assistance and customer service. These Centers are located in Lakewood, Colorado Springs, Pueblo, Fort Collins, and Grand Junction in order to provide taxpayers with face to face accessibility to help with filing, payments, information, and other resources. Our PuebloService Centerlocation is seeking a courteous and friendly team player with experience working in a diverse, customer focused environment to serve as aTax Examiner I. Our best Tax Examiners are adaptable and have strong computer software applications proficiency. Most of all, they possess a willingness and desire to learn and grow in an evolving atmosphere! The Typical Day of aTax Examiner I You will be offering friendly, courteous, and complete customer service by ascertaining tax needs of all walk-ins into the Service Center. You will also be responding to questions from taxpayers via email and mailed forms . You'll be joining a close-knit team who promotes team building and supporting each other. If you're ready to enjoy the benefits of being a State employee, then this job may be for you! As a Service Center team member you will: Direct all customers to the correct areas by identifying customers' problems and needs. Answer ambiguous questions related to all tax types when a customer is unclear or uncertain about tax forms, Statutes and Regulations, DOR policies, delinquencies and assessments. Promote voluntary compliance with tax laws through researching customer problems, identify solutions and needs, and take corrective actions in accordance with policies, Statutes, and Regulations. Assist with sales tax, wage withholding and income tax returns. Coordinate protest solutions with other DOR areas and other agencies through the supervisor. Analyze and adjust returns, accounts and customer information using DOR systems. This position will be located in our office and you will be required to work in person. Minimum Qualifications, Substitutions, Conditions of Employment & Appeal Rights Residency Requirement: This posting is only open to residents of the State of Colorado at the time of submitting your application. Class Code & Classification Description: TAX EXAMINER I (H8N1XX) Tax Examiner class series description available online M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: Must meet one of the following or any combination of experience/education to meet the minimum (MQ) qualifications: OPTION 1: Two (2) years of experience in a customer service environment. AND High school diploma or General Education Diploma (GED). OR OPTION 2: Associate's degree in Accounting, Business, Economics, Finance or a related field as determined by the Department. NOTE: If submitting a transcript, certification or other relevant materials, candidates may redact information that identifies their age, date of birth, or dates of attendance at or graduation from an educational institution. Substitutions: A combination of related education and/or relevant experience in an occupation related to the work assigned equal to two (2) years Preferred Qualifications: The ideal candidate will possess the following skills: State experience working with GenTax Demonstrated ability to communicate with people outside the organization, representing the organization to customers, the public, government, and other external sources. Ability to multi task in a fast-paced environment with strong attention to detail and thorough in completing work tasks Proficient with Google Suite Strong problem solving skills Conditions of Employment with theCDOR: Employees are in a position of public trust in the performance of their job duties and must operate in a manner that maintains the highest standards of honesty, integrity, and public confidence. As a condition of employment with the CDOR, all personnel must file all necessary Colorado Individual Income Tax (CIIT) returns and pay tax obligations, therefore all employees must undergo a pre-employment evaluation of their tax records/accounts to ensure compliance with this policy. Final candidates must also complete a successful background investigation and reference check prior to appointment. Certain positions based on duties may require scheduled background investigations.
